Strategies for Test Automation: Streamlining the Testing Process
Efficient system testing relies heavily on automation. By utilizing effective test automation strategies, development teams can significantly enhance the speed, accuracy, and breadth of their testing efforts. These approaches often involve leveraging specialized tools to execute repetitive tasks, releasing testers to focus on more sophisticated aspects of the testing process. Key elements of successful test automation comprise clear test scripts, robust framework selection, and continuous evaluation to ensure optimal effectiveness.
